How Much Does Yard Grading Cost in the Twin Cities?
For a typical Twin Cities home, a reasonable starting estimate for yard grading is about $1,000 to $6,400. That broad range reflects the difference between correcting a small low spot and reshaping most of a yard for drainage. A national reference point puts the average grading project near $2,300, but local site conditions can move the final price well above or below that figure. These numbers are planning estimates, not a quote or guarantee.
For a smaller residential area of roughly 1,000 to 2,000 square feet, homeowners may see an estimate around $1,000 to $3,000. A full backyard regrade commonly falls closer to $2,000 to $5,000. Published pricing references also describe grading at approximately $0.08 to $2.00 per square foot. Or about $50 to $180 per hour when work is priced by labor and equipment time. Because these are broad industry ranges, the estimate should be tied to the actual yard rather than calculated from a single national average.
Project scope is the biggest reason the yard grading cost can change. A small correction near a foundation may start around $500, while extensive leveling combined with a full drainage system can reach $15,000. The upper end is associated with substantially more work, such as moving large amounts of soil. Rebuilding the grade across the entire yard, improving drainage, or working around existing landscaping and structures. Whole-yard leveling is much more complex than correcting one isolated area, so it requires more planning, material, equipment time, and labor.
| Project scope. | Typical estimate range. | What it usually involves. |
|---|---|---|
| Small low-spot or foundation correction. | About $500 to $1,500. | Filling one low area, adjusting slope near the foundation, limited material. |
| Typical residential yard (roughly 1,000 to 2,000 sq ft). | About $1,000 to $3,000. | Broad re-grade with moderate material movement and finish grading. |
| Full backyard regrade. | About $2,000 to $5,000. | Rebuilding grade across most of the yard, drainage work, more material. |
| Extensive leveling with full drainage work. | Can reach $15,000. | Whole-yard reshaping, imported aggregate or fill, significant drainage improvements. |

What Drives Residential Yard Grading Pricing?
A grading quote reflects more than the size of a yard. The contractor has to determine how much earth must move, where it needs to go. How precisely the finished surface must drain, and whether equipment can reach the work area. The main pricing factors are square footage, slope complexity, access, soil condition, and the amount of fill dirt or aggregate required. These factors are also useful for understanding what land grading is and why two yards with similar dimensions can receive very different estimates.
Total area and the amount of earth to move
A larger yard usually means more machine time, more passes to establish the grade, and more material to cut, spread, or haul away. However, square footage is only the starting point. A small low area may need just a limited amount of fill. While a broad backyard with several inches of uneven settlement may require substantially more material and labor. Ask whether the estimate covers excavation, spreading, removal of excess soil, and final shaping so you are comparing the same scope.
Slope design and drainage requirements
Grading is intended to move water where it belongs, not simply make the surface look level. Most homes need at least a 2% slope away from the foundation. In practical terms, that is a drop of roughly 6 inches over 10 feet. Sources including the University of Minnesota Extension emphasize that surface water should be managed before it can create moisture problems around a structure: review its guidance on basement moisture.
A straightforward slope across an open lawn is generally easier to establish than drainage around additions, retaining walls, walkways, driveways, downspouts, or multiple low spots. Steep or hilly yards can cost more because the operator may need to cut into high areas. Bring in fill for low areas, make several elevation transitions, and work more carefully to avoid erosion. The more complicated the drainage path, the more time is needed for layout, shaping, and verification.
Equipment access and site conditions
Equipment access has a direct effect on productivity. A skid steer can move and spread material efficiently when there is a clear route from the driveway or street to the work area. Narrow gates, fences, landscaping, overhead obstacles, soft ground, and limited staging space may require smaller equipment, extra hand work, or additional material-handling time. A steep lot can also restrict safe operating areas and make each load or pass less efficient.
Soil type, condition, and material volume
Soil type and condition change how easily the yard can be cut, shaped, compacted, and finished. Dense clay, wet soil, rocks, roots, frozen ground, or poorly compacted existing fill may require additional preparation. The quote also depends on whether the project needs imported fill dirt, black dirt, sand, or aggregate, and how many loads are needed. Material volume is often one of the largest cost variables because it affects both supply and delivery. Why Minnesota’s Wet Ground and Clay Soils Raise the Cost
Minnesota grading is not performed on a blank, dry canvas. Twin Cities yards commonly deal with wet spring conditions, dense or clay-heavy soil, freeze-thaw movement, and a short window for outdoor construction. Each condition can increase the labor, equipment time, or material handling required to produce a stable grade that moves water away from the house.
Wet ground is especially important. When soil is saturated, equipment access can become difficult, and moving across the yard can create ruts or compact some areas while leaving others unstable. A crew may need to wait for workable conditions, use more deliberate equipment placement, or return to fine-grade and repair disturbed areas. Those added steps affect the final yard grading cost, even when the lot itself is not unusually large.
Clay-heavy soil can also make the work less forgiving. It may be difficult to cut, spread, and compact evenly when wet, then harden as it dries. Frost adds another variable because seasonal soil movement can alter low spots and drainage paths. A grading plan should account for where water will go after the surface settles, not just how the yard looks on the day the equipment leaves.
Drainage problems can become basement problems
Proper grading is about water movement, not simply leveling. The University of Minnesota Extension explains that improper slope away from a foundation is a common cause of basement water issues in Minnesota homes. Its guidance also notes that moisture problems in existing basements are very common, and symptoms can include standing water, damp floors, odors, and mold or mildew.
That is why a low area near the foundation may require more care than a cosmetic correction elsewhere in the yard. The finished surface needs to direct rainwater away from the structure and work with gutters, downspouts, and the surrounding landscape. Depending on the site, the solution may require removing soil, importing fill, rebuilding a slope, or correcting several connected areas instead of filling one visible depression.

Do I Need Professional Yard Grading for Drainage Issues?
Professional grading is worth considering when water repeatedly pools near the foundation, erosion returns after rain, or runoff moves toward the house instead of away from it. A minor, isolated low spot may be manageable with careful soil and planting adjustments. Persistent drainage patterns are different. They often require a systematic assessment of where water starts, how it travels across the property, and whether the finished grade supports the surrounding structures.
The University of Minnesota Extension notes that improperly sloped ground is a common contributor to basement water problems in Minnesota. Water that remains near the foundation can contribute to damp conditions and, over time, damage wood headers, joists, sill plates, and other structural elements. When a site assessment makes sense
Ask for a professional assessment if you notice standing water beside the foundation, recurring washouts. Exposed roots, soil movement, or a low area that collects runoff from a roof, driveway, or walkway. An assessment can help separate a grading correction from other possible needs, such as downspout changes, a drainage collection feature, or a planted low area.
For example, a rain garden is a planted low area designed to let runoff soak into the ground from hard surfaces such as roofs, driveways, and walkways. It can be part of a broader drainage plan, but it should be placed and shaped with the property’s water flow in mind. The University of Minnesota Extension also explains that these areas can help filter pollutants before water reaches groundwater or surface-water systems. How to Get an Accurate Yard Grading Cost Estimate
A useful estimate starts with a clear description of the site, not just a request to “level the yard.” Before requesting pricing, gather the details below. They help a grading professional understand the scope, equipment needs, and amount of material involved.
- Measure the yard area. Estimate the square footage of the section that needs work. It does not have to be survey-grade, but note the length and width of each irregular area, then add them together. Separate the work area from patios, decks, planting beds, and other surfaces that should remain untouched. Total square footage is one of the factors that can change the labor, equipment time, and material volume required.
- Assess the existing slope and water flow. Walk the yard after rain if possible. Mark where water collects, where it runs toward the house, and where it leaves the property. Note whether the project involves a gentle correction or a steep, complicated slope. As a general reference, a 2% grade drops about 6 inches over 10 feet. The correct solution depends on the site, but this gives you a practical way to describe the direction and approximate severity of the slope.
- List the fixes you need. Be specific about the outcome. You may need a small drainage correction near the foundation, low spots filled, a swale shaped, or a complete re-grade of the yard. Include related work such as removing unsuitable soil, improving drainage, or preparing an area for seed, sod, or a patio. A focused correction and a full re-grade are very different scopes, so naming the desired fix makes a yard grading cost estimate more useful.
- Describe access and barriers. Explain how equipment would reach the work area. Mention narrow gates, fences, retaining walls, landscaping, overhead wires, septic components, sheds, or soft ground. Accessibility affects which equipment can be used and how efficiently material can be placed. Photos from the driveway, side yard, and work area can help clarify conditions before a site visit.
- Estimate fill dirt or aggregate needs. Identify the low areas and estimate how deeply they need to be raised. Even a rough length, width, and average depth helps establish material volume.
